Effects of Fertilization Levels of Nitrogen, Phosphorus and Potassium on the Quality of Cut Flowers and Bulb-lets of Lily

Abstract:

To compare the effects of nitrogen(N), phosphorus(P) and potassium(K) fertilizers on the growth of cut flowers and bulb-lets of lily, OT lily ‘Huangjinjia’ was used as the experimental material to study the effects of different fertilization levels of a single fertilizer on the quality characteristics of cut flowers and bulb-lets of lily. The results showed that N-fertilizer increased the dry weight and girth of lily bulb, P-fertilizer promoted the growth of dry and fresh weight, girth and diameter of bulbs, and the growth of bulbs increased with the application of K-fertilizer of 100 and 200 kg/hm 2, but decreased with the application of 300 kg/hm2 K-fertilizer. The effect of P-fertilizer was the most obvious, followed by that of K and N fertilizer. When the application of P-fertilizer was 50 kg/hm2, the bulbs had the maximum growth. P and K fertilizer could promote the increase of plant height, leaf length and width, leaf area and flower diameter in cut flowers. However, there was no significant change in the characteristics of the plants under the treatment of N-fertilizer. When the application amount of K and P fertilizer was 100 kg/hm2 respectively, their efficiency was similar, but the P treatment could lead to more increase in the flower diameter. In summary, the demand of N-fertilizer for bulb-lets is greater than that for cut flowers. The application of P and K fertilizer could improve the quality of bulbs and cut flowers, but the two fertilizers have different effects on cut flowers and bulb-lets. It is suggested that the suitable P-fertilizer for bulb-lets should be 50 kg/hm2, and for cut flowers should be 100 kg/hm2, while K-fertilizer should be 100 kg/hm2for both bulb-lets and cut flowers. N-fertilizer should not be applied separately.
